Job Expired
This Software Engineer (MIS/IT 5) position is no longer active. Check out similar roles or browse our latest listings.

Software Engineer (MIS/IT 5)
Summary
Under the leadership and direction of the Manager, Business Process and Application Development, the Software Engineer is responsible for designing, implementing and maintaining features and functionalities of ICT solutions, websites and digital platforms, ensuring high-performance and availability. The Software Engineer manages all technical aspects of website development and partners with the Corporate Communications and PR Branch in content management. đź’°Salary: $4,266,270.00 - $5,737,658.00 JMD per annum.
Responsibilities
Technical/Professional:
- • Develops and maintains knowledge of the Ministry’s and its subjects ICT applications portfolio, development tools, and development procedures;
- • Actively participates in the development and review of business and system requirements to obtain a thorough understanding of business needs to deliver accurate solutions;
- • Develops high quality software code in accordance with established ICT standards and development guidelines;
- • Produces technical documentation that accurately and thoroughly depicts the software design and code base;
- • Confers with end users and various divisional representatives in resolving questions of programme/system intent, output requirements, input data acquisition, and inclusion of internal checks and controls;
- • Performs programme maintenance, modifications, and enhancements to new/existing systems through programming, testing, documenting, and training users;
- • Performs adequate unit testing and evaluation of application development work, ensuring requirements are addressed, basic functionality works, and errors are handled properly;
- • Expeditiously troubleshoots application production issues that resolve the concerns without causing additional problems;
- • Reviews and analyzes the effectiveness and efficiency of existing systems and develops strategies for improving or further leveraging these systems;
- • Provides updates on work in progress, work completed, work planned, and issues potentially impacting the on-time completion or quality level of work;
- • Works with stakeholders to gather and analyze project specifications and flow charts;
- • Leads cross-functional and technical groups/committees to address the ICT operations of the Ministry and subjects as required;
- • Partners with the Corporate Communications and PR Branch in content management for websites and related media platforms;
- • Establishes and maintains effective working relationship with external service providers, customers, and other units/branches/divisions;
- • Assists with the training of staff in the use of computer hardware and software solutions;
- • Keeps abreast of trends and developments in ICT and initiates/recommends their use where necessary to improve the work of the department/division.
- • Remains current on ICT policies/programmes and related GOJ policies/initiatives to ensure compliance;
- • Remains competent and current through self-directed professional reading, developing professional contacts with colleagues, maintaining membership in professional organizations and participating in ICT and Software Development initiatives.
Management/Administrative:
- • Develops Individual Work Plan based on alignment to the overall plan for the section;
- • Participates in meetings, seminars, workshops and conferences as required;
- • Prepares reports and programme documents as required;
- • Maintains customer service principles, standards and measurements.
Human Resources:
- • Contributes to and maintains a system that fosters a culture of teamwork, employee empowerment and commitment to the Branch’s and organization’s goals;
- • Assists with the preparation and conducts presentations on role of Branch/Unit for the Orientation and Onboarding programme.
Other:
- • Performs all other duties and functions as may be required from time to time.
Required Skills
Core:
- • Adaptability
- • Compliance
- • Customer and Quality Focus
- • Initiative
- • Integrity
- • Interpersonal
- • Oral Communication
- • Team Work & Cooperation
- • Time Management
- • Written Communication
Technical/Functional:
- • Accountability
- • Attention to Detail
- • Financial Management
- • Goal/Results Oriented
- • Methodical
- • Planning and Organising
- • Problem Solving and Decision-making
- • Resilience
- • Stress Tolerance
- • Technical Skills
- • Technology Management
- • Technology Savvy
- • Use and Application of Technology
Other:
- • Expert knowledge in Information Technology system procedures and practices;
- • Good knowledge of information technology fundamentals and programming languages
- • Ability to gain detailed knowledge of in-house programming languages, programme design and development procedures, turnover procedures, and housekeeping standards
- • Ability to perform analysis of straightforward system functionality
- • Ability to gain detailed knowledge of general system architecture and functionality, as well as detailed knowledge of specific sub-systems
- • Working knowledge of commonly used concepts, practices, and procedures as it relates to software development
- • Ability to effectively manage time while working on multiple assignments with/without guidance as to relative priorities of assignments
- • Knowledge of database design and file management techniques
- • Principles of project estimation and planning
- • Ability to monitor and report on programme/project budgets
- • Good Knowledge of GOJ ICT systems (existing and emerging)
- • Strong ability to synthesize multiple ideas and complex information into a coherent summary, as in reports and briefing notes, and to make cogent recommendation for the modification or creation of legislation, policies and programmes
Qualifications
- • Bachelor’s Degree in Software Design, Computing, Computer Science, ICT, Management Information Systems, Computer Engineering, or a related discipline;
- • Specialized training in Applications/Software Development;
- • Three (3) years related experience.
Additional Information and Instructions
Specific Conditions associated with the job:
- • Work will be conducted in an office outfitted with standard office equipment and specialized software.
- • The environment is fast paced with on-going interactions with critical stakeholders and meeting tight deadlines which will result in high degrees of pressure, on occasions.
- • May be required to travel locally and overseas to attend conferences, seminars and meetings.
Kindly submit cover letter and resume along with the name, telephone number and email address of two (2) references, one must be a former/current supervisor no later than Friday, July 4, 2025 to: Senior Director, Human Resource Management and Development Ministry of Justice 61 Constant Spring Road, Kingston 10 or via Website đź”— Click the Apply link to apply via MOJ Website The Ministry of Justice thanks all applicants for their interest, but only those shortlisted will be contacted.
Share This Job
Job Overview
Title
Software Engineer (MIS/IT 5)
Company
Ministry of Justice (MOJ)Location
Kingston and St. Andrew, JamaicaSalary
See Description
Work Style
On-SiteContract
Permanent
Experience
Mid-Level
Education
Bachelor's Degree
Category
IT & NetworkingSector
Public
👉 Mention IslandHints when applying. Support trusted platforms prioritizing safety!
Never pay fees for applications—requests for equipment, training, or ID verification may signal fraud.
Verify employers via official domains or secure platforms.
See Safety Tips →Explore Related Job Categories
Job Search Resources
Government of Jamaica Job Listings
Explore official government job vacancies across various ministries and agencies in Jamaica.
Visit SiteWorkplace Politics: A Guide to Surviving & Thriving
Learn strategies to navigate and excel in workplace dynamics.
Read ArticleThe Importance of Soft Skills: Beyond Technical Know-How
Understand the value of soft skills in professional success and how to develop them.
Read Article